## Step 3: Pin the component library version

Heads up — starting with Brambleware UI Kit 7.x, the shared components no longer float to "latest." Each app has to pin an exact version in its manifest, otherwise the build bot at Fernhollow will refuse to publish. If a customer reports mismatched button styles, that's almost always an unpinned version sneaking in. After pinning, re-run the registry sync so the version table gets updated. The sync tool talks to the registry database using the connection that follows.

warehouse DSN: mssql://rusdor_svc:0FSWCn9@db-951a.paliqforge.local:5432/ulawyn

Vendor note: Brightmoor Systems delivers webhooks with at-most-once semantics by default. We contractually require at-least-once with exponential backoff, retried for 24 hours, and idempotency keys on every payload. Verify these settings during each contract renewal, and record any deviation in the vendor register. For clarification on the agreed retry schedule, write to the vendor liaison.

billing contact of kajeg-tahof = soriel.istwyn.aldeth@ferragrid.corp

Runbook — Catalog Cache Flush (Pemberly Storefront). When product prices look stale after a publish, don't panic: the edge cache on the Quillon tier holds entries for 15 minutes. Run the invalidation job from the ops console, wait for the sweep counter to hit zero, then spot-check three SKUs. If staleness persists, the write-through layer is lagging — restart it. Quote the trace token shown just below when filing a report.

session token of yajof-bagef = htk4_937d

// A new contractor changed this once without checking the renderer, and the
// preview stretched past its container on long recordings — please don't
// repeat that. The value must divide evenly into the canvas width used by
// the Oxhollow player, currently 960px. If you change it, regenerate the
// cached previews and re-run the visual regression suite. The token from
// that suite run belongs immediately below.

session token of fahap-hawip = htk31_7852f2b3276dba2738f98fa97f92237